Augeiai
Augeiae

A city on the southern Peloponnesian Peninsula.

  During the Trojan War, Menelaos (Menelaus), co-commander of the Achaian (Achaean) army, mustered soldiers from the Lakedaimon (Lacedaemon)1 cities of Augeiai, Amyklai (Amyclae), Bryseiai (Bryseiae), Helos, Laas, Messe, Oitylos (Oetylus), Pharis, and Sparta.

1. Lakedaimon—also called Lakonia (Laconia)
